A09327 Summary:

BILL NOA09327
 
SAME ASSAME AS S08916
 
SPONSORWoerner
 
COSPNSRMcDonald
 
MLTSPNSR
 
Amd 642, Exec L
 
Provides for certain victim statements to be taken at their workplace instead of the police department where such workplace was the scene of the crime and is a hospital, emergency medical facility, nursing home or residential health care facility.

A09327 Text:



 
                STATE OF NEW YORK
        ________________________________________________________________________
 
                                          9327
 
                   IN ASSEMBLY
 
                                    February 29, 2024
                                       ___________
 
        Introduced  by M. of A. WOERNER -- read once and referred to the Commit-
          tee on Codes
 
        AN ACT to amend the executive law, in relation to providing for  certain
          victim statements to be taken at their workplace instead of the police
          department
 
          The  People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and Assem-
        bly, do enact as follows:

     1    Section 1. Section 642 of the executive law is amended by adding a new
     2  subdivision 6 to read as follows:
     3    6. Unless a victim of an assault in  the  second  degree  pursuant  to
     4  section  120.05  of  the  penal law chooses to make their statement at a
     5  police department, as that term is defined in subdivision a  of  section
     6  eight  hundred  thirty-seven-c  of  this  chapter,  such victim shall be
     7  interviewed by the police in their workplace  providing  such  workplace
     8  was  the scene of the crime and is a hospital, emergency medical facili-
     9  ty, nursing home, or residential health  care  facility  as  defined  in
    10  section  twenty-eight  hundred  one  of  the  public health law, or is a
    11  facility or hospital as defined in section 1.03 of  the  mental  hygiene
    12  law.
    13    § 2. This act shall take effect on the one hundred twentieth day after
    14  it shall have become a law.
